  • Title

    Enhanced passive equaliser using open-stub structure

  • Abstract
    An open-stub compensation technique is proposed for passive equalisers used in high-speed digital communication systems. By simply lumping an open stub to the conventional RL-type passive equaliser, the frequency-dependent channel loss from the long transmission path can be compensated, the frequency response of the channel becomes more flat and the bandwidth is wider. On comparing the proposed passive equaliser with typical RL passive equalisers, the simulation results show that the proposed technique can achieve an improvement by 1 GHz in the flat region of S21 on a 60 cm-long differential pair. Thus, the proposed technique successfully demonstrates an improvement in electrical performance of about 57.4% in the time domain.
